Position Summary

The Patient Access Specialist will be responsible for delivering a dynamic customer experience to all customers and demonstrate a strong commitment to service excellence.

The Patient Access Specialist is responsible for obtaining demographic, insurance, and medical information to ensure an accurate and complete registration.

Performing insurance verification, data collection and documentation.

Maintains proper documentation in all systems.

Identifying patient financial responsibilities and collecting applicable monies.

Acting as liaison to all internal and external customers to facilitate access to hospital services.

Secures all necessary documentation to register the patient's visit. Process authorizations electronically, utilizing payer portals, fax, or telephone working with the payers to secure authorizations.

Works cooperatively and provides coverage for responsibilities of co-workers when assigned or as need arises.

Answers telephone, responds to questions, directs calls, and documents messages.

Develops and promotes the use of effective methods of communicating with physicians, managers, peers, trainees, and staff on a regular basis.

Maintains the confidentially of patient's records and any related work.

Effectively communicate needs of Physicians and staff in requirements of documentation for proper reimbursement.

Checks for data errors and uses them as examples for educating team members.

Adhere to contractual requirements of Medicare, Medicaid, and managed care plans.

Run daily update and insurance exception reports.

Complete all end of day responsibilities.

Performs other duties as assigned.

Physical Requirements

Involves daily contact with insurance companies and / or patients, by writing, telephone, via computer programs and / or in person within an office environment. Requires sitting for long periods of time, also stooping, bending, standing and stretching. May require lifting up to 20 lbs. Must have manual dexterity for typing and computer data entry.

Threshold Requirements

These threshold requirements are required and completed yearly basis. Annual Joint Commission mandatory education requirements, in-service and health requirements including attendance at new employee orientation, TB / PPD Surveillance Program and Maintenance of required professional licensing and / or certification(s).
